Understanding industrial cables is essential for guaranteeing reliable electrical distribution in diverse applications. These specialized wires are created to endure extreme conditions, such as significant temperatures, damage, and corrosive exposure. Selecting the correct cable type – be it power cables, control cables, or data cables – relies on the certain requirements of the operation . Top Industrial Wiring Manufacturers Internationally
Identifying the definitive top industrial wiring manufacturers globally is a difficult task, but several companies consistently rank among the leaders . Lapp are known for their high-quality products and wide portfolio, catering to industries like aerospace, automotive , and heavy machinery. Other key players include Prysmian , offering a variety of bespoke solutions. Southwire also holds a robust position within the market, known for their creativity and commitment to sustainable practices. Choosing the Best Cable for Manufacturing Uses
Selecting the suitable cable for industrial environments is essential for maintaining reliability continuity and avoiding costly downtime . Evaluate factors such as heat ranges, presence to corrosive substances, and the type of electrical being carried. Heavy-duty cable design , including shielding and jacket compound, must be meticulously considered to withstand the demanding conditions experienced in various factory settings.

Wiring Solutions for Severe Industrial Environments
Heavy-duty cable offerings are critical for ensuring stable performance in challenging factory environments. These engineered wires must resist extreme conditions, motion, dampness, and corrosive contact. Features such as shielding, thick insulation, and unique constructions deliver extended performance and reduce interruptions within important applications.
